Optimize Images for Speed

Images can significantly impact your website’s loading speed, so optimizing them is crucial. Large, unoptimized images can slow down your site, leading to a poor user experience and lower search rankings.

Start by compressing your images without sacrificing quality. Use tools like TinyPNG or ImageOptim to reduce file sizes effectively.

Next, choose the right format. JPEGs work well for photos, while PNGs are better for images with transparency. If you want to go further, consider using modern formats like WebP, which provide excellent quality at smaller sizes.

Don’t forget to set the proper dimensions for your images. Upload images that match the display size on your website. This way, your browser won’t waste time resizing them.

Lastly, implement lazy loading for your images. This technique loads images only when they’re about to enter the viewport, reducing initial load times.

Leverage Browser Caching

One effective strategy to boost your website’s loading speed is leveraging browser caching. When a user visits your site, their browser saves certain files like HTML, CSS, and images. The next time they visit, the browser retrieves these files from its cache instead of downloading them again, significantly speeding up load times.

To implement browser caching, you’ll need to set specific expiration dates or a maximum age for your resources. By doing this, you’re instructing browsers to store files locally for a set period.

If you want to get started, you can modify your server settings. If you’re using Apache, adding a few lines to your .htaccess file can do the trick. For Nginx users, you can adjust the server configuration directly.

Make sure to balance caching duration; while longer caching periods reduce load times, they can delay updates to your site.

Also, consider using tools like Google PageSpeed Insights to analyze your caching effectiveness and identify areas for improvement. By leveraging browser caching, you’ll not only enhance your website’s speed but also improve user experience, encouraging visitors to return.

Minify CSS and JavaScript

After implementing browser caching, another effective way to enhance your website’s performance is to minify your CSS and JavaScript files.

Minification reduces file size by removing unnecessary characters, such as whitespace, comments, and formatting. This practice not only speeds up load times but also decreases data transfer, helping improve your Google PageSpeed score.

Here are three key benefits of minifying CSS and JavaScript:

  1. Faster Loading Times: Smaller files load quicker, which keeps users engaged and reduces bounce rates.
  2. Improved Performance: By minimizing the amount of code the browser has to download, you free up resources, allowing your website to run smoother.
  3. Enhanced SEO: Search engines favor fast-loading sites. By improving your site’s speed, you may boost your rankings and visibility.

To get started, you can use various tools and plugins that automate the minification process.

Make sure to test your website after minifying to ensure everything functions correctly. By taking this step, you’re on your way to achieving a faster, more efficient website that both users and search engines will appreciate.

Enable Compression

Enabling compression is a powerful technique to boost your website’s performance and speed. When you compress your files, you reduce their size, which means they load faster for your visitors. This not only enhances user experience but also positively impacts your Google PageSpeed score.

To get started, you can use protocols like Gzip or Brotli for compressing files such as HTML, CSS, and JavaScript. Most web servers support these options, making it easy for you to implement. If you’re on a shared hosting plan, check with your provider to see if they already have compression enabled.

If it’s not set up, you can usually enable it through your server configuration files, like .htaccess for Apache servers. Just add a few lines of code to activate compression.

After you enable compression, don’t forget to test your website to ensure all files are being compressed correctly. Tools like Google PageSpeed Insights can help you verify that your efforts are paying off.

Reduce Server Response Time

Reducing server response time is crucial for enhancing your website’s overall performance. A fast server response means users get the information they need quickly, leading to a better user experience and improved search engine rankings.

Here are three effective strategies to help you reduce server response time:

  1. Optimize Your Hosting Plan: Choose a hosting provider that offers the best performance for your needs. If your traffic is growing, consider upgrading to a dedicated server or VPS instead of shared hosting.
  2. Implement Caching: Use caching mechanisms like server-side caching, browser caching, and content delivery networks (CDNs) to store copies of your static resources. This reduces the amount of time the server takes to process requests and delivers content faster.
  3. Minimize HTTP Requests: Reduce the number of elements on your pages, such as scripts, images, and stylesheets. Combining files and using CSS sprites can significantly cut down on the number of HTTP requests, speeding up load time.
